6 FAQs about [500 W photovoltaic panel size]

How much does a 500 watt solar panel weigh?

500 watt solar panels are typically constructed from 144 half-cut monocrystalline cells. A 500W panel has a typical footprint of about 27.5 square feet. Each 500W solar panel weighs approximately 71.2 lbs (32.3 kg). Is it worth it to invest in 500-watt solar panels for your home?

Are 500 watt solar panels bigger?

500-watt solar panels are bigger than your average solar panel. Typically made up of 144 half-cut monocrystalline cells, their large size makes 500-watt solar panels more commonly seen in commercial, ground-mounted, and utility solar projects. For residential solar projects, is bigger always better? That’s not necessarily the case.

What is a 350W solar panel?

They’ll be using solar system “size” to refer to the combined total of each solar panel’s wattage or power output. In the UK, a standard 350W residential solar panel is around 1.89m long, 1m wide and 3.99cm thick and contains approximately 60 solar cells.

Can a 500 watt solar panel be used on a roof?

500 watt solar panels have their uses, but not on the roof of your house. Because of their size and weight, they are neither practical nor cost-effective in most residential solar situations. The size of your solar panels can impact your system’s effectiveness and savings.

Are 500 W solar panels worth it?

Their size and weight make them less practical to install in most residential solar situations, nor are they cost-effective. The large footprint of 500 W solar panels makes them harder to fit into the nooks and crannies of a residential roof.

Should I install a 500W solar panel?

500W solar panels are mostly used in large-scale installations where the panel’s physical size is unimportant.
